Key Applications of Industrial Protective Coatings
Industrial protective coatings are widely used in the following environments:
- Chemical industry: Anti-corrosion coatings can effectively resist the erosion of chemical substances and protect equipment and pipelines.
- Marine engineering: The coating has strong salt spray resistance and is suitable for the anti-rust requirements of the marine environment.
- Manufacturing industry: Improve the wear resistance of mechanical equipment and extend its service life.
- Construction Industry: Provides additional protection for structures against moisture and mold.
Advantages of Industrial Protective Coatings
Choosing the right protective coating can bring the following advantages to the company:
- Durability: High-quality protective coatings are able to maintain their performance under extreme conditions.
- Reduce maintenance costs: effectively prevent equipment corrosion and damage, and reduce the frequency of maintenance and replacement.
- Improve safety: Reduce potential safety hazards caused by equipment failure and protect employee safety.
- Improve brand image: Good equipment management and maintenance can enhance the company's market reputation.
How to choose the right industrial protective coating
When selecting industrial protective coatings, companies should consider the following factors:
- Environmental conditions: Select the appropriate coating type based on the actual environment where the equipment is located (such as humidity, temperature, etc.).
- Performance requirements: clarify specific requirements such as corrosion resistance, wear resistance, and chemical corrosion resistance.
- Application method: Consider the coating construction method and time cost.
- Economical: Pursue cost-effectiveness while meeting performance requirements.
